What is a food manager?

Food Managers are professionals responsible for overseeing the daily operations of food service establishments such as restaurants, cafeterias, and catering services. They ensure that food safety regulations are followed, manage staff, handle inventory and ordering, and maintain quality standards. Food Managers also address customer concerns, plan menus, and implement policies to maximize efficiency and profitability. Their role is essential for ensuring that customers receive safe, high-quality food and excellent service.

What are some common challenges a food manager faces in maintaining food safety standards, and how can these be addressed?

Food Managers often encounter challenges such as ensuring staff consistently follow food safety protocols, staying updated with changing regulations, and managing high-volume operations without compromising quality. To address these issues, successful managers implement regular training sessions, conduct frequent audits, and foster a culture of accountability among team members. Building strong communication with staff and maintaining detailed records also help prevent lapses in food safety and ensure compliance with local health codes.

How hard is it to get a food manager certification?

Becoming a food manager typically requires completing a food safety certification course, such as ServSafe or a similar program, which covers topics like food handling, sanitation, and safety procedures. The certification process usually involves passing an exam and may require some prior experience in food service; the difficulty depends on the individual's familiarity with food safety principles. Most certifications are achievable with study and preparation within a few weeks.

Job Summary
Each day at Taziki's is a little different - part of what keeps it exciting! You might have an opening shift or a closing shift.
For an opening shift, mornings are spent helping your prep crew ready the store for lunch service and preparing catering orders for guests, keeping a close eye on food safety practices and recipe perfection. Before the doors open, gather your team for pre-shift (or even a family meal!), and catch them up on the newest Taziki's updates like a recipe change or a new feature of our Taz Rewards program. You'll enjoy meeting the great people in your community as you touch tables and help guests with their Take-Out orders - get to know them by name! During the afternoons, managing shift change, you'll juggle helping on the line while getting a PM prep sheet ready or looking ahead at dinner orders coming in online.
If you're working a PM shift, once you check the state of your team's stations, you'll help the team push through busy online ordering hours for Take-Out dinners while giving Dine-In guests great service as well. As the shift winds down, you'll use your evening counts and tomorrow's catering orders to make prep sheets for your AM team, setting them up for another successful day!
